Bullets Disappearing

I am new to Scrivener, so please bear with me. The bullets in my writing sometimes disappear when I change the formatting of a line below them. For example, let’s say paragraph one has no style, then there are five bullets, and then I start another paragraph. The last paragraph at first will be a bullet just like the previous five. So let’s say I want to leave the previous five bullets alone and change just the last paragraph. I put the cursor in the last paragraph and select “None” for bullet/numbering. When I do that, “None” is applied not only to the last paragraph, but also to the previous five bullets. So I select those five and select bullets again.

This has been happening to me repeatedly. So I’m thinking there is something I don’t understand about the formatting. Any help would be appreciated.

I’ve moved this to the macOS section as it might be specific to the engine.

I think though you can achieve what you are looking for by changing how you input lists slightly. Instead of manually selecting “none” when you are done with a list, just press Return twice.

Thanks Amber! That helped. Pressing Return twice breaks the connection to preceding paragraphs. Appreciate the help.
